Product Description
The Salzburg-born conductor who was revered from Vienna and Berlin to London and The Met was, thankfully, an immensely prolific recording artist. This 88-CD box will thrill and move you for hours and hours as he conducts the Vienna Philharmonic Orchestra, Philharmonia Orchestra, Berlin Philharmonic Orchestra and more. Among the masterworks: "Symphony No. 4 in E Minor" Brahms; "Symphony No. 5 in C Minor; Symphony No. 9 in D Minor" Beethoven; "Symphony No. 9 in C Major" Schubert; "Eine Kleine Nachtmusik" Mozart; "Symphony No. 6 in B Minor" Tchaikovsky; "The Four Seasons" Vivaldi; "Symphonie Fantastique" Berlioz; "Rhapsodie Espagnole" Ravel; "La Mer" Debussy; "Concerto for Orchestra" Bartok; "Pictures at an Exhibition" Mussorgsky; "Piano Concerto in A Minor" Schumann; "Symphony No. 2 in D Major" Sibelius, and much more!
